
Two EA-18G Growler aircraft collided midair during the Gunfighter Skies air show at Mountain Home Air Force Base, forcing four crew members to eject; officials said all aircrew were in stable condition and injuries were not life-threatening. The crash sparked a brush fire and shut Grand View Highway (Idaho 167) for several days while investigators assess the cause. The event canceled the remainder of the air show, but the market impact is likely limited and localized.
The immediate market read is not on defense primes’ earnings, but on the rising probability of a prolonged safety review that tightens the operating envelope for demonstration teams, training flights, and public-facing aviation events. That creates a subtle but real drag on the broader military aviation ecosystem: fewer demo appearances, delayed schedules, and higher compliance costs for operators, insurers, venue hosts, and local logistics tied to air shows. The first-order financial impact is small, but the second-order effect is a near-term compression in event cadence and ancillary revenue for the travel/leisure stack around regional air shows. The more interesting angle is legal and municipal liability. Even if the ultimate finding is pilot error or mechanical anomaly, the combination of a public event, roadway closure, medical response, and prior incident history raises the odds of tougher permit requirements, higher event insurance, and more conservative base-level approvals over the next 6-18 months. That tends to hit smaller event organizers and local hospitality demand before it shows up in any large-cap financial line item. For defense contractors, this is not a procurement thesis either way unless the investigation uncovers a platform-specific fault pattern. If it does, the impact would be asymmetrical: any remediation burden on a niche electronic attack fleet is likely manageable, but headlines around operational reliability can still pressure sentiment and delay non-urgent orders or upgrades for weeks. The bigger risk is reputational, not fundamental, unless regulators expand the scope into fleet-wide inspections.
